dazzle (n.)

  1. brightness enough to blind partially and temporarily

    dazzle (v.)

  1. to cause someone to lose clear vision, especially from intense light; She was dazzled by the bright headlights

    [ Syn: bedazzle , daze ]

  2. amaze or bewilder, as with brilliant wit or intellect or skill; Her arguments dazzled everyone; The dancer dazzled the audience with his turns and jumps'
